Health and Safety Policies:
For the protection of your child and the other children, parents are requested not to bring a child who appears to be ill. A child
should not be placed in our care of PNO when any of the following exist: fever – currently or within previous 24 hours, vomiting
or diarrhea, persistent nasal or eye drainage which is green or yellow in color, any symptom of a childhood disease (scarlet
fever, German measles, mumps, chicken pox, common cold, sore throat) any unexplained rash, any skin infection, pink eye or
other eye infection. If staffs observe any symptoms that may fall into these categories, you may be asked not to participate for the
safety of the other children.
We will not administer any medication.
If your child develops a fever or other symptoms of illness while in our care, he/she will be separated from other children and the
parents will be contacted to take the child home.
